27 | /** | |
28 | * Represents all XWiki configuration options for the Mail Sending feature. | |
29 | * | |
30 | * @version $Id: 3640ce2a940bdbe3496773f2cbec6f60bab0f86e $ | |
31 | * @since 6.1M2 | |
32 | */ | |
33 | @Role | |
34 | public interface MailSenderConfiguration | |
35 | { | |
36 | /** | |
37 | * @return the SMTP server | |
38 | */ | |
39 | String getHost(); | |
40 | ||
41 | /** | |
42 | * @return the SMTP server port | |
43 | */ | |
44 | int getPort(); | |
45 | ||
46 | /** | |
47 | * @return the SMTP user name to authenticate to the SMTP server, if any | |
48 | */ | |
49 | String getUsername(); | |
50 | ||
51 | /** | |
52 | * @return the SMTP password to authenticate to the SMTP server, if any | |
53 | */ | |
54 | String getPassword(); | |
55 | ||
56 | /** | |
57 | * @return the default email address to use when sending the email. This is optional and if the user of the API sets | |
58 | * it, then it overrides this default value | |
59 | */ | |
60 | String getFromAddress(); | |
61 | ||
62 | /** | |
63 | * @return the list of default email addresses to add to the BCC mail header when sending email.This is optional and | |
64 | * if the user of the API sets it, then it overrides this default value | |
65 | * @since 6.4M2 | |
66 | */ | |
67 | List<String> getBCCAddresses(); | |
68 | ||
69 | /** | |
70 | * @return the list of additional Java Mail properties (in addition to the host, port, username and from | |
71 | * properties) to use when sending the mail (eg {@code mail.smtp.starttls.enable=true} if TLS should be | |
72 | * used). See <a href="https://javamail.java.net/nonav/docs/api/com/sun/mail/smtp/package-summary.html">Java | |
73 | * Mail Properties</a> for the full list of available properties. | |
74 | */ | |
75 | Properties getAdditionalProperties(); | |
76 | ||
77 | /** | |
78 | * @return the full list of Java Mail properties to use when sending the email (this includes the Java Mail | |
79 | * properties for host ({@code mail.smtp.host}), port ({@code mail.smtp.port}), | |
80 | * username ({@code mail.smtp.user}), from {@code mail.smtp.from}) + the all the additional properties | |
81 | * from {@link #getAdditionalProperties()} | |
82 | */ | |
83 | Properties getAllProperties(); | |
84 | ||
85 | /** | |
86 | * @return if true then the SMTP server requires authentication | |
87 | */ | |
88 | boolean usesAuthentication(); | |
89 | ||
90 | /** | |
91 | * @return the hint of the {@link org.xwiki.mail.script.ScriptServicePermissionChecker} component to use to check if a | |
92 | * mail is allowed to be sent or not when using the Mail Sender Script Service API. For example: | |
93 | * "alwaysallow", "programmingrights". | |
94 | * @since 6.4M2 | |
95 | */ | |
96 | String getScriptServicePermissionCheckerHint(); | |
97 | ||
98 | /** | |
99 | * @return the delay to wait between each mail being sent, in milliseconds. This is done to support mail throttling | |
100 | * and not considered a spammer by mail servers. | |
101 | * @since 6.4RC1 | |
102 | */ | |
103 | long getSendWaitTime(); | |
104 | } |
